GHOUL HOOLIGAN
The smell of smashed gourds and seventeen-thousand football-frenzied ghouls tanked up on Kadathian Spiced Black Tar Cacao Lager.

I got this hoping it would mainly smell like chocolate stout and tar. Instead, it smells like CINNAMON with some chocolate and a little tar.

 

Wet, it's tons of cinnamon, like a red hot candy, backed by a liberal amount of pumpkin. It's the fresh, sweet, watery variety of pumpkin, as was in Pumpkin Smash! Unfortunately, like Pumpkin Smash, the tar note is far too weak for what I apparently long for. I can barely pick it out as a dark grittiness grounding the whole scent. There is a strong chocolate scent also. I suppose the pumpkin note is stronger, but chocolate is just so recognizable that it seems to dominate.

 

As it wears, the cinnamon fortunately fades a bit, and the pumpkins gains some ground as a result. Some of the beeriness comes out, with the cinnamon no longer drowning it. The tar also becomes a little more noticeable. So, it becomes a tiny bit less foody, but it's still rather dessert-like. It's like dessert with a hint of dark incense.

 

In short, I'd call this a heavily spicy, deep chocolate blend lightened by pumpkin but grounded by smoky tar.

In the bottle, this smells like a mess of dark sweetness (like cinnamon brown sugar, maple syrup, sugared nuts, and chocolate). I figured that this would be way too sweet and/or way too heavy on the spices, so I'm surprised that I actually love this scent. I was also worried that "smashed gourds" would turn out to be bpal's buttery pumpkin note, but I don't get anything buttery like that here.

 

I have trouble with cinnamon blends going too sharp on my skin, but this is a sugared, dark, soft cinnamon. I don't think that it smells like red hots candies at all (I hate red hots candies); this is smoother and softer, and doesn't have the sharpness of red hots. Something about this scent is like a background of dry, sugared wood notes as well (maybe the dark chocolate giving me that impression). It's not overly sweet or overly spicy. I find this very dark, smooth, and wearable. It screams fall to me, but I'll wear this all year 'round.

 

This scent is so cozy and wonderful. I'm going to need at least one more bottle, though a little dab of the oil has tons of throw and staying power on me.
